Reserve yourself a spot for a week's worth of Ashtanga Vinyasa essentials from January 22 to 26, 2018 with Richard Freeman + Mary Taylor in Boulder, Colorado.



A five-day intensive designed for beginning yoga students, which is offered in Boulder, Colorado each year. Designed for beginning students and those new to Ashtanga Vinyasa yoga, this course offers insights into the interlinking aspects of the practice. Students explore the internal forms of alignment that are essential to practicing in a balanced, intelligent, and safe manner. The course also includes an introduction to chanting, pranayama, and Indian philosophies.



Mary Taylor began studying yoga in 1971, soon after she came home from France with a grande diplôme from Julia Child’s cooking school, L’Ecole des Trois Gourmandes. She found yoga at first a means of finding equanimity during the stress of University, and it was that thread of balance that got her hooked.



Richard Freeman began the study of yoga in 1968 at the Chicago Zen Center while working on an MA in philosophy.  He has produced a number of highly regarded yoga audio and video recordings; and is the author of 
The Mirror of Yoga and co-author (along with Mary Taylor) of 
The Art of Vinyasa (Shambhala Publications).He currently travels throughout the world teaching yoga, philosophy, and meditation. 



Mary and Richard are co-founders of 
Freeman+Taylor.
